Why Correct Sealant Materials Last While Duct Tape Fails in Midfield, AL

Standard duct tape uses a rubber-based adhesive that performs at room temperature but dries and loses adhesion when repeatedly exposed to the temperature extremes that duct systems experience during HVAC operation in Midfield. A supply duct carrying cold conditioned air through a 130-degree summer attic cycles through extreme temperatures with every cooling cycle in Midfield, AL. Standard duct tape adhesive is not formulated for this cycling and fails within a few seasons in Midfield. Mastic sealant remains flexible after curing and maintains its seal through years of thermal cycling in Midfield, AL. UL 181-rated foil tape maintains adhesion for 20 years or more in normal duct system conditions in Midfield.

Where Leaks Occur

Where Duct Leaks Occur and Why They Develop in Midfield, AL

At Every Unsealed Duct Joint Throughout the System in Midfield

Every connection between duct sections is a potential leak point in Midfield, AL. In most residential installations, these joints were mechanically fastened without sealant during installation in Midfield. Over years of thermal cycling that expands and contracts the ductwork with every HVAC cycle, even joints that were initially sealed with standard duct tape have failed as the tape dried and lost adhesion in Midfield, AL.

At Branch Takeoffs From the Main Trunk Line in Midfield, AL

Branch takeoffs split conditioned air from the main trunk line into the individual branch runs serving each room in Midfield. They have multiple edges and angles that create significant potential leak area if not correctly sealed in Midfield, AL. Branch takeoff leaks are among the largest individual leak points in typical residential duct systems in Midfield.

At Register Boot Connections in Walls and Ceilings in Midfield

The register boot connects the branch duct run to the wall, ceiling, or floor opening where the supply register mounts in Midfield, AL. The connection between the flexible duct and the boot collar and the connection between the boot and the surrounding framing are both common significant leak points in Midfield. Conditioned air escaping at the boot level leaks into the wall or ceiling cavity rather than through the register into the room in Midfield, AL.

Why Original Installation Sealant Fails Over Time in Midfield, AL

Systems sealed with standard duct tape develop leakage as the tape dries, cracks, and loses adhesion from temperature cycling in Midfield. Standard duct tape on duct joints typically fails within three to five seasons of thermal cycling in Midfield, AL. Joints that were sealed with standard tape appear sealed when first applied and are open to leakage again within a few years in Midfield.

How Leaking Ducts Create Comfort Problems Room by Room in Midfield, AL

Supply duct leakage between the trunk line and the registers means rooms furthest from the air handler receive less conditioned air than they were designed to receive in Midfield. The conditioned air that leaks out before reaching the register does not reach the room in Midfield, AL. Rooms at the end of long duct runs with multiple leak points along the way receive the cumulative effect of all those leaks in Midfield. The room that is always too hot in summer and too cold in winter is often at the end of a duct run with multiple unsealed joints in Midfield, AL.

What Return Duct Leaks Do to Your Indoor Air Quality in Midfield, AL

Return duct leaks draw air from the surrounding unconditioned space into the return airstream in Midfield. A return duct leak in an attic draws hot, dusty attic air into the air handler in summer in Midfield, AL. A return duct leak in a crawl space draws crawl space air including moisture, mold spores, and soil particulate into the system in Midfield. This unconditioned air bypasses the filter and is distributed throughout the home in Midfield, AL.

Sealant Materials

What MBM Uses to Seal Duct Leaks in Midfield, AL

Mastic Sealant — The Professional Standard in Midfield

Mastic is a water-based sealant specifically formulated for duct system applications in Midfield, AL. It remains flexible after curing, maintaining its seal through the thermal cycling that duct systems experience in Midfield. It does not dry out, crack, or lose adhesion from temperature cycling the way standard duct tape does in Midfield, AL.

UL 181-Rated Foil Tape for Specific Applications in Midfield, AL

UL 181-rated foil tape is tested and rated specifically for HVAC duct applications in Midfield. Unlike standard duct tape, it maintains its adhesion through the temperature cycling of duct system operation in Midfield, AL. Appropriate for specific sheet metal seam applications in Midfield.

Standard Duct Tape Is Never Used in Midfield

Standard silver duct tape is not rated for duct system applications in Midfield, AL. Its rubber-based adhesive dries and loses adhesion from temperature cycling in Midfield. MBM Air Duct Cleaning never uses standard duct tape for duct sealing work in Midfield, AL.

Yes. Return duct leaks in crawl spaces draw crawl space air including its elevated moisture content into the return airstream in Midfield. The additional moisture enters the air handler and is distributed throughout the home in Midfield, AL. Indoor relative humidity rises despite the air conditioner running because the additional crawl space moisture load overwhelms the system's dehumidification capacity in Midfield.
Aeroseal is a technology that seals duct leaks from inside the pressurized duct system in Midfield. Aerosolized sealant particles are introduced into the system and travel to leak points where they accumulate and seal the gap in Midfield, AL. It is needed when significant leakage exists in duct sections in wall cavities or ceiling plenums that cannot be physically accessed for manual sealant application in Midfield.
